Terrible Crash Driver Unconscious At Egbe

Operatives of the Lagos State Traffic Management Authority (LASTMA) today, 30th April, 2023, rescued an unconscious accident victim on top Cele-Egbe Bridge inward Ikotun, Lagos.

Lastma Anjorin Adeola (Zebra 7 Ejigbo) who led the rescue team confirmed that the unconscious crash victim was the truck driver involved in an accident where a white six (six) tyre truck with registration number: (FFF 996 XB) loaded with biscuits fell on an unregistered blue Toyota Camry (Unregistered) inward Ikotun, Lagos

According to a statement by Adebayo Taofiq, Director, Public Affairs and Enlightenment Department of LASTMA quoted
Anjorin as confirming that the accident was very serious as the side of the truck fully loaded with biscuits fell on top of a blue (unregistered) Camry car.

He stated the LASTMA Officials handed over the rescued driver to Police men from Ejigbo Divisional Police Headquarters.

The General Manager of LASTMA, Mr Bolaji Oreagba disclosed that the Agency is currently extending public education/enlightenment on speed limit to motor parks including truck/trailer garages across the State.

While imploring motorists to exercise necessary cautions before over-taking high capacity buses/trucks on highways, Mr. Oreagba maintained that speed limit sign posts erected by the government be strictly adhered to by all motorists
